What Is M.Tech in Robotics?
M.Tech in Robotics is a master’s course in engineering that lasts for 2 years. It educates the student on how robots work and what a smart machine should be like. The course involves:
- Robotics engineering
- Artificial intelligence (AI)
- Control systems
- Sensors and automation
- Mechatronics
- Programming for robotics
- Machine vision
- Human-robot interaction

Who is eligible to apply for M.Tech in Robotics?
The M.Tech in automation and robotics is for candidates possessing an already established science or engineering background and working in technical sectors. The minimum qualification is:
- Education: B.E. or B.Tech Mechanical, Electrical, Electronics, Mechatronics, Computer Science or equivalent.
- Experience: Few colleges would want to see work experience among the applicants, particularly for part-time programs.
- Entrance: There are certain colleges that insist on a GATE score or have their own entrance test, but working professional courses might accept direct entry based on interview and experience.

What You Will Learn in the Course
Some of the main subjects that are usually taught in M.Tech in Robotics are as follows:
Robotics Systems Engineering
Understand how to control and design robotic machines.

- Machine Learning and AI: Implement intelligence into robots so that they can make choices.
- Sensors and Actuators: Learn about robots’ perception of the world and how they move.
- Automation and PLCs: Learn about robots’ application in industries for automation.
- Robot Programming: Programme to control robot movement and action.
- Simulation and 3D Modelling: Simulate and model robots on software prior to actual construction.
You can also pursue a capstone project or industry internship that enables you to transform what you are learning into real-world solutions.
